summaryrefslogtreecommitdiff
diff options
context:
space:
mode:
authorRoger Dingledine <arma@torproject.org>2009-10-27 02:26:58 -0400
committerRoger Dingledine <arma@torproject.org>2009-10-27 02:26:58 -0400
commit8c34e792630fa32a3f472d875e25e6f25078d7e0 (patch)
tree7a816f6ed93b25ae14d775bdeaed14fdb4e7d6f9
parent19ddee5582bf6dc3d53cb31944de23277341eab6 (diff)
parentc8b27a8e9eed58ea1a8e8be36289b474f4942c11 (diff)
downloadtor-8c34e792630fa32a3f472d875e25e6f25078d7e0.tar.gz
tor-8c34e792630fa32a3f472d875e25e6f25078d7e0.zip
Merge commit 'karsten/log-1092'
-rw-r--r--src/or/rendservice.c8
1 files changed, 6 insertions, 2 deletions
diff --git a/src/or/rendservice.c b/src/or/rendservice.c
index f00cfd44d8..b6981d6258 100644
--- a/src/or/rendservice.c
+++ b/src/or/rendservice.c
@@ -1553,6 +1553,7 @@ directory_post_to_hs_dir(rend_service_descriptor_t *renddesc,
}
for (j = 0; j < smartlist_len(responsible_dirs); j++) {
char desc_id_base32[REND_DESC_ID_V2_LEN_BASE32 + 1];
+ char *hs_dir_ip;
hs_dir = smartlist_get(responsible_dirs, j);
if (smartlist_digest_isin(renddesc->successful_uploads,
hs_dir->identity_digest))
@@ -1574,15 +1575,18 @@ directory_post_to_hs_dir(rend_service_descriptor_t *renddesc,
strlen(desc->desc_str), 0);
base32_encode(desc_id_base32, sizeof(desc_id_base32),
desc->desc_id, DIGEST_LEN);
+ hs_dir_ip = tor_dup_ip(hs_dir->addr);
log_info(LD_REND, "Sending publish request for v2 descriptor for "
"service '%s' with descriptor ID '%s' with validity "
"of %d seconds to hidden service directory '%s' on "
- "port %d.",
+ "%s:%d.",
safe_str(service_id),
safe_str(desc_id_base32),
seconds_valid,
hs_dir->nickname,
- hs_dir->dir_port);
+ hs_dir_ip,
+ hs_dir->or_port);
+ tor_free(hs_dir_ip);
/* Remember successful upload to this router for next time. */
if (!smartlist_digest_isin(successful_uploads, hs_dir->identity_digest))
smartlist_add(successful_uploads, hs_dir->identity_digest);